NASNA Street Newspaper Awards
On Fri., July 31 the North American Street Newspaper Association (NASNA) announced the winners of its 2009 awards at a ceremony in Denver, Colo. Encompassing a variety of diverse categories such as Best Interview, Best Series, Best Vendor Essay and Best Cover Design, the awards celebrated the increasing popularity and high-quality journalism displayed by North American street papers. NASNA Executive Director Andy Freeze said, “The contribution of North American street papers to the communities they serve cannot be underestimated. The past year has seen a huge surge in the popularity of street papers in cities across America and the NASNA Awards has been a way of recognizing the great and important work they provide.” To read the award-winning articles and view pictures from the awards ceremony, visit streetnewspapers.wordpress.com.
